Bohurupi will have its streaming debut on ZEE5 (OTTplay Premium) beginning May 9, 2025. This riveting film, which was directed by Nandita Roy and Shiboprosad Mukherjee, is based on actual bank robberies that occurred in West Bengal from 1998 to 2005.

In the 1990s drama Bohurupi, the unlawful incarceration of Bikram (Shiboprosad Mukherjee) throws his life into chaos. While incarcerated, he forms an alliance with a seasoned bank robber and eventually becomes an expert imposter, planning daring heists like the one at the Ajaygunj Co-operative Bank. An intense pursuit ensues between him and police officer Sumanta Ghosal (Abir Chatterjee) as a result of his acts. Bohurupi tells a compelling story of perseverance in the face of a corrupt system by combining exciting action with profound themes of morality, justice, and identity.

Director duo on the themes behind Bohurupi

Shiboprosad Mukherjee (Ramdhanu) and Nandita Roy discussed the film, saying that with Bohurupi, they wanted to explore how far a man can go when pushed to the edge by a system meant to protect him. The story is about more than just crime and disguise; it's also about finding one's voice in a culture that tends to censor the truth, all set against the background of a dangerous era. Bohurupi is more than merely a heist drama, and they're thrilled that ZEE5 is giving it to a broader audience with its world digital premiere. They hope viewers connect with the emotional depth and thrilling twists that make it so.
